HP has developed technology of memory from 1970

In research laboratories of company Hewlett-Packard the new element of electronic schemes which existed before only in theory is created. Developers managed to create “memristor” (from English memory - memory and resistor - the resistor). The new microscopic system, according to HP, is capable in a root to change systems and methods of storage of electronic data, writes CyberSecurity.

Memristoryi will allow to create chips of memory of the future which data without an electricity throughout the long period of time are capable to savethat will allow to avoid long process of loading of computers, to raise their productivity, and also repeatedly to lower energopotreblenie the electronic engineering.

The concept “Memristor” has been entered for the first time into use in far 1971 by the professor of the Californian university Leon CHua then the basic properties and indicators of this system have been described. However on realising this idea in practice, 37 years were required.

In laboratory HP in Has fallen-alto (sht California, the USA) researchers have constructed a working prototype memristora, having placed microscopic films dioksida the titan between two electrodes and have passed through them an electric current. "Memristoryi are capable to remember the condition at the moment of passage of a charge by means of change of the nuclear structure. Actually the charge memristora can correspond to a charge of the passed current. Basic difference of these systems consists in it from all others", - Williams has explained.
